Features and Benefits

The key features of Colgate Total Mouthwash include:

  1. CPC: Colgate Total Mouthwash contains CPC (cetylpyridinium chloride), which is a powerful ingredient that can help reduce plaque and gingivitis and fight harmful germs in the mouth.
  2. Fluoride: The mouthwash contains fluoride, which is a mineral that can help strengthen teeth and protect against cavities.
  3. 12-hour protection: The mouthwash provides 12-hour protection against germs that cause plaque and gingivitis.
  4. Alcohol-free: Colgate Total Mouthwash is alcohol-free, making it an excellent option for people who are sensitive to alcohol or prefer a non-alcoholic mouthwash.
  5. Multiple flavors: The mouthwash comes in various flavors, including Peppermint Blast, Clean Mint, and Fresh Mint, to suit different preferences.
  6. Affordable: Colgate Total Mouthwash is competitively priced and widely available, making it accessible for most people.
  7. Clinically proven: The CPC in Colgate Total Mouthwash has been clinically proven to help reduce plaque and gingivitis.
  8. Easy to use: Colgate Total Mouthwash is straightforward to use. You simply rinse your mouth with the mouthwash for 30 seconds twice a day after brushing your teeth.

Colgate Total Mouthwash is an alcohol-free mouthwash that promises to provide 12-hour protection against germs that cause plaque and gingivitis.

It contains fluoride, which helps strengthen teeth and protect against cavities. Its unique formula also claims to reduce 99% of germs in the mouth, including those that cause bad breath.

One of the unique features of Colgate Total Mouthwash is that it contains a patented ingredient called CPC (cetylpyridinium chloride), which is known for its germ-fighting properties.

CPC has been clinically proven to help reduce plaque and gingivitis, making it an excellent choice for people who are concerned about their oral health.

Effectiveness

Colgate Total Mouthwash is an effective mouthwash that can help fight bad breath, reduce plaque, and prevent gum disease. Its unique formula containing CPC and fluoride provides long-lasting protection against harmful germs in the mouth.

However, it is important to note that mouthwash alone cannot replace a good oral hygiene routine that includes brushing and flossing regularly.

Taste

Colgate Total Mouthwash comes in several flavors, including Peppermint Blast, Clean Mint, and Fresh Mint. Most people find the taste of Colgate Total Mouthwash to be pleasant and refreshing, with no overpowering aftertaste.

However, taste preferences are subjective, so you may want to try a few different flavors to find the one that suits you best.

Side Effects

Like any other mouthwash, Colgate Total Mouthwash may cause some side effects, although they are relatively rare. Some people may experience a mild burning or tingling sensation in their mouth after using the mouthwash.

This is usually temporary and should go away within a few minutes. If you experience any discomfort or irritation, stop using the mouthwash and consult your dentist.

FAQs:

Is Colgate Total Mouthwash safe to use every day?

Yes, Colgate Total Mouthwash is safe to use every day as directed on the label. However, it is essential to follow the instructions and not exceed the recommended usage.

Can Colgate Total Mouthwash replace brushing and flossing?

No, Colgate Total Mouthwash cannot replace brushing and flossing. Mouthwash can help maintain good oral hygiene, but it cannot remove plaque and food particles from teeth and gums like brushing and flossing can.

Does Colgate Total Mouthwash cause staining on teeth?

No, Colgate Total Mouthwash should not cause staining on teeth. However, if you have concerns about staining or discoloration, you should consult your dentist.

Is Colgate Total Mouthwash suitable for people with sensitive teeth?

Yes, Colgate Total Mouthwash is suitable for people with sensitive teeth. However, if you experience any discomfort or irritation, stop using the mouthwash and consult your dentist.

Can children use Colgate Total Mouthwash?

Colgate Total Mouthwash is not recommended for children under six years old. Children over six years old can use the mouthwash under adult supervision.

Does Colgate Total Mouthwash contain alcohol?

No, Colgate Total Mouthwash is alcohol-free, making it an excellent option for people who are sensitive to alcohol or prefer a non-alcoholic mouthwash.

How long should I rinse my mouth with Colgate Total Mouthwash?

You should rinse your mouth with Colgate Total Mouthwash for 30 seconds twice a day after brushing your teeth. Do not swallow the mouthwash.

Can I use Colgate Total Mouthwash if I have braces or other dental appliances?

Yes, Colgate Total Mouthwash is safe to use if you have braces or other dental appliances. However, it is essential to follow the instructions and rinse thoroughly to ensure that all areas of the mouth are covered.
